Output 3b88d657f8c7bbea11a0537950697246aa30d710c91734377299f86bf8c0e7e8:12

value
45362774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3596fd5598adf379db5ec8e357bf9d2819a7ff OP_EQUAL
address
3N3Eook6nGgj1kdg4kZZXMGKc5ZNp5GScY
transaction
3b88d657f8c7bbea11a0537950697246aa30d710c91734377299f86bf8c0e7e8
spent
true